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Cameron Bridge to Pontefract Tanshelf start from as little as £22.50

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Cameron Bridge to Pontefract Tanshelf start from £73.20 one way

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Cameron Bridge to Pontefract Tanshelf are available for £83.70 one way

Facilities and Amenities at Cameron Bridge

At Cameron Bridge, purchasing and collecting tickets is a seamless experience, thanks to the ticket machines available on site. These machines allow travelers to retrieve tickets purchased online, and they are accessible to all, including those requiring assistance. The station supports smartcard technology, which provides a modern, efficient way to travel across the rail network.

For those needing assistance or information, there are customer help points available, although staff help at the station isn't offered. Step-free access throughout the station ensures hassle-free navigation for everyone, regardless of mobility requirements. Although there's no waiting room or refreshment facilities, you'll find shelter and seating on the platform to make your wait comfortable.

The station's car park has a generous capacity with 125 spaces available, free of charge. However, it does not include accessible parking spaces. Cyclists can rejoice with the station's bike storage that accommodates 26 bicycles under sheltered stands.

Facilities and Services

Though small, Pontefract Tanshelf station is equipped with essential ticketing facilities. There is no traditional ticket office; however, passengers can take advantage of available ticket machines to collect online purchases and buy tickets for their journey. While the station does not offer accessible ticket machines or major amenities such as lounges or waiting rooms, it ensures safety and security through its CCTV installation.

For those requiring additional assistance, the station encourages the use of the help line, though it lacks an on-site staff support system. Accessibility is well considered with step-free access provided, allowing ease of movement for those with impaired mobility. Passengers can navigate the station without encountering barriers, thanks to a ramped footbridge available for platform access. Moreover, if travel assistance is needed, passengers can utilize the Passenger Assist service, a notable feature helping facilitate access for everyone.

Onward Travel

Rail replacements and bus services are conveniently accessible, with bus stops located just a short stroll away from the station, particularly near the HiQ Garage on Stuart Road. Taxi services can also be arranged via the Cab4You service, connecting travelers with local taxi operators for seamless transfers. While bicycle hire is not available directly at the station, cyclists can make use of limited bicycle storage spaces in the car park area.
